Capacity note for the Hoistline dispatch simulator. Worst-case load is the lobby-surge scenario: all cars idle, then a burst of hall calls within one tick. Memory scales linearly with simulated shafts; CPU with call-queue depth. For review purposes, all inputs are bounded by compile-time constants, so no untrusted value can grow a buffer. Those bounds are defined below.

tuning constants:
QUOTAS = {
    "druwyn": 5,
    "holix": 5,
    "zorath": 5,
    "holwyn": 10,
}

Subject: DR drill Thursday — webhook retry path

Reviewer: Thursday's drill exercises failover of the Pulsegate webhook dispatcher at Ferndale Systems. We will verify retry semantics: exponential backoff, 24h cap, dedupe on delivery IDs, and dead-letter handling after the fifth attempt. Standby region takes over mid-retry; confirm no duplicate or dropped deliveries. Scope doc attached. To unseal the standby dispatcher's signing store during the drill, use the recovery passphrase noted below.

unlock words, yawig-kagef: gordor-holvan-ulaael-pramir-ulaiel-tamdor

Subject: Fleet fuel-usage report — on-call notes

Hi, welcome to the Roadminder rotation. The nightly fleet fuel-usage report aggregates plugin-submitted telemetry, so malformed payloads from third-party plugins are the usual failure cause. Check the validation log first, then the aggregation job status, in that order. Plugin authors are expected to follow the payload spec documented on our internal page.

runbook for badug-kadup: https://confluence.zemvarlabs.internal/projects/browse/display/projects/bd1b